Analysis

Malawi recorded 1,271 t for wheat — burning crop residues in 2050. That is the highest value across all 65 years on record.

Over the whole period, wheat — burning crop residues in Malawi peaked at 1,271 t in 2050 and was at its lowest, 40 t, in 1961.

That places Malawi 110th out of 125 countries with data for 2050, putting it in the bottom quarter.

The series is highly variable year to year, so single readings are best treated with caution.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
